On Wed, Apr 15, 2026 at 01:41:04PM +0200, Franz Schnyder via lists.yoctoproject.org wrote:
> From: Franz Schnyder <franz.schnyder@toradex.com>
>
> The `ti-eth-fw-j784s4` firmware is added in the generic J784s4 SoC
> include, which is therefore used for all the J784s4-based machines.
> That firmware seems to be developed specifically for the EVM, as it
> takes control of pins used for the Ethernet board setup on the EVM. On
> non-EVM boards, like the Aquila-AM69, those signals are used for other
> functions, so enabling the firmware in the SoC include is too broad
> and breaks functionality.
>
> Move the machine-essential recommend from the SoC include
> to the EVM configuration.
>
> Signed-off-by: Franz Schnyder <franz.schnyder@toradex.com>
> ---
> meta-ti-bsp/conf/machine/include/j784s4.inc | 2 +-
> meta-ti-bsp/conf/machine/j784s4-evm.conf | 2 ++
> 2 files changed, 3 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)
>
> diff --git a/meta-ti-bsp/conf/machine/include/j784s4.inc b/meta-ti-bsp/conf/machine/include/j784s4.inc
> index 4dc3a71b..e0ce81b5 100644
> --- a/meta-ti-bsp/conf/machine/include/j784s4.inc
> +++ b/meta-ti-bsp/conf/machine/include/j784s4.inc
> @@ -12,7 +12,7 @@ TFA_BOARD = "j784s4"
>
> OPTEEMACHINE = "k3-j784s4"
>
> -MACHINE_ESSENTIAL_EXTRA_RRECOMMENDS += "cadence-mhdp-fw cnm-wave-fw ti-eth-fw-j784s4"
> +MACHINE_ESSENTIAL_EXTRA_RRECOMMENDS += "cadence-mhdp-fw cnm-wave-fw"
>
> TI_CORE_INITRAMFS_KERNEL_MODULES = "kernel-module-cdns-pltfrm kernel-module-ti-j721e-ufs"
> TI_CORE_INITRAMFS_KERNEL_MODULES:bsp-ti-6_6 = ""
> diff --git a/meta-ti-bsp/conf/machine/j784s4-evm.conf b/meta-ti-bsp/conf/machine/j784s4-evm.conf
> index bf53b07c..f80e030f 100644
> --- a/meta-ti-bsp/conf/machine/j784s4-evm.conf
> +++ b/meta-ti-bsp/conf/machine/j784s4-evm.conf
> @@ -27,3 +27,5 @@ KERNEL_DEVICETREE = " \
> "
>
> UBOOT_MACHINE = "j784s4_evm_a72_defconfig"
> +
> +MACHINE_ESSENTIAL_EXTRA_RRECOMMENDS:append = " ti-eth-fw-j784s4"
Can this be done with += instead of :append?
